This time, David Arakhamia, one of the most influential characters in the “Servant of the People” team, finds himself under a real threat of being suspected of treason. And although the scenario was not implemented, its very appearance became a signal: the struggle for influence crosses the line of a classic parliamentary conflict and falls into the realm of state security.

Where did the idea of suspicion come from: the leak in the Mindić case and the search for the “saboteur”
According to leading media outlets and insiders from the President's Office, the presentation of suspicion to Arakhamia was part of a broader campaign — a reaction to growing discontent in the Servant of the People faction due to the scandal surrounding Mindich.Phone: 1 2 3 It was about trying to find the “culprit” in the leak of information about corruption schemes in the energy sector, when criticism and demands for the resignation of Andriy Yermak reached their peak.
Details of the “fabrication”: contacts with Abramovich and the artificial “Russian trace”
The key argument for suspicion of treason was Arakhamia's contacts with Russian oligarch Roman Abramovich, which had existed since the Istanbul negotiations in 2022. According to the logic of the OP's technologists, this could be interpreted as a manifestation of "Russian influence" 1 2, which destabilizes the Ukrainian government and becomes a convenient marker for political pressure.
The main goal of the scenario is to neutralize the internal opposition.
The idea of handing over suspicion is not just a way to "grab the hand" of a potential competitor, but an actual attempt to weaken resistance within the faction and regain control. For many deputies, the signal was clear: opposition is turning from internal discussions into a career risk, and political battles are taking on the character of uncompromising confrontations.
Why the scenario was not implemented: the principled position of the security forces
Despite the willingness of some of the OP leadership, as well as pressure to agree and even threats of resignation, neither the head of the SBU, Vasyl Malyuk, nor Prosecutor General Ruslan Kravchenko agreed to sign the indictment.Phone: 1 2 3 Sources claim: none of the security forces wanted to participate in the implementation of a scenario that could create a new political precedent and damage the balances in the government.
